No, bgh games DO require skill at the highest level (of bgh gamers). I too was under the misconception that bgh requires only macro, until i started playing it. You need solid micro, supremely solid macro, good builds (which are unique to bgh) and excellent team coordination to win. In my experience, at the highest level, 3v3 and 2v2 bgh games are harder than team hunters game you'll find in korean channels like brood war ladder on west.
